Supply chain optimization is critical for the success of any industry. In textiles, it involves managing the flow of goods from manufacturers to consumers. Traditionally, this process has been labor-intensive and prone to errors. However, AI is changing the game.

AI can analyze vast amounts of data quickly. In Morocco, textile companies can use AI tools to forecast demand accurately. By understanding consumer preferences and market trends, businesses can produce the right amount of fabric or clothing. This reduces overproduction and waste, leading to substantial cost savings. For instance, using AI algorithms, a Moroccan textile manufacturer can analyze sales data, customer feedback, and social media trends to anticipate future demand.

Moreover, AI helps with inventory management. Managing stock levels is crucial for minimizing costs and meeting customer demands. AI systems can track inventory in real-time, alerting managers when stocks are low or when items are not selling as expected. This helps companies maintain optimal inventory levels, ensuring that they have enough products without overstocking.

Transportation and logistics are also critical components of the textile supply chain. In Morocco, AI can optimize delivery routes, reducing transportation costs and improving delivery times. By analyzing traffic patterns and delivery schedules, AI systems can determine the fastest and most efficient routes for transporting goods. This not only saves money but also enhances customer satisfaction by ensuring timely deliveries.

Additionally, AI plays a role in quality control. High-quality products are vital for maintaining brand reputation in the textile industry. AI-powered tools can inspect fabrics and finished products for defects. These systems can identify issues much faster and more accurately than human inspectors, ensuring that only top-quality products reach the market.
